Power & Run Time
With its dual-fuel technology, the Champion 201507 delivers 120/240V, and offers power and flexibility. Running on gasoline, it boasts a running wattage of 8,500W and a peak wattage of 10,625W. When powered by propane, it delivers 7,650 running watts and 9,565 peak watts.
Featuring a noise rating of 74 dBA (just slightly more noisy than a shower), the generator is equipped with both a traditional recoil pull-start mechanism and a simple and elegant electric starter (battery included) for starting.
With a fuel capacity of 7.7 gallons, the 201507 can operate for around 10 hours at 50% load using gasoline (fuel consumption around 0.77 GPH), or for around 5 hours (on a 20 lbs tank - propane consumption around 0.94 GPH) using propane.
Given the 201507's high Total Harmonic Distortion (THD) of less than 20%, it is advisable to avoid using it to power sensitive electronic devices.

While this Champion generator is not RV Ready, its L5-30R receptacle can be used for a simple RV connection with an L5-30P to TT-30R adaptor. Besides, as the 201507 holds a twist-lock L14-30R receptacle, it is transfer switch ready: you'll easily be able to connect it to your breaker box to power your home during a power outage.
Portability
With its L28.9 x W27.7 x H26.1 in dimensions, the open frame structure of the Champion 201507 provides stability, simplified maintenance access to components, and better air cooling than enclosed units. The featured design is ideal for the outdoors and all tough environments.
Despite its weight of 209 lbs, the generator is still considered 'portable,' meaning it is movable, although its heftiness may restrict portability in certain environments or require additional considerations for transportation and setup. Nevertheless, it can still be moved quite conveniently with the help of its wheel kit (⌀9.5") and its folding handle, once it is placed on the ground.
Features
The 201507's control center features an Intelligauge meter, providing voltage, frequency, and lifetime hours data to aid you with the monitoring of its status and activity.
With its built-in fuel gauge, the generator provides quick and convenient gas level checks.
Security-wise, this product benefits from an overload protection (circuit breaker) and an automatic low oil shut-off, which gives you a complete peace of mind when using it. Champion's built-in surge protector (Volt Guard™) safeguards your equipment and appliances against voltage spikes.
The unit also benefits from the CO Shield™ technology, which monitors accumulation of poisonous carbon monoxide (CO) gas produced by the engine's exhaust when the generator is running. If CO Shield™ detects elevated levels of CO gas, it automatically shuts off the engine and illuminates a red LED.

About Champion Power Equipment
Founded in 2003, the Champion Power Equipment is a US based power equipment manufacturer. The relatively small company has made a name for itself both in the portable generator industry, but also the power equipment sector in general, with a particular focus on heavy duty equipment, such as log cutters, snow blowers, chipper shredders, etc. All of their products are engineered in the US. However, the company does not provide information on the origin of their components.
